In a world where acquisition costs are skyrocketing, funding is scarce, and ecommerce merchants are forced to do more with less, the most innovative DTC brands understand that subscription strategy is business strategy. Recharge is simplifying retention and growth for innovative ecommerce brands.

Requirements

  • 5+ years of relevant full stack development experience across back-end such as Python, and front-end experience including JavaScript and/or TypeScript
  • 3+ years of experience with a major modern Web UI framework (e.g. ReactJS) and experience building UI at scale
  • Familiarity with micro-service architecture
  • Demonstrable cloud computing experience
  • Demonstrable expertise with JavaScript, Python, and Cloud Platforms such as GCP or AWS

Responsibilities

  • Build, maintain, and debug high-impact, high-performance, high-scale products enabling our merchants storefront experiences.
  • Perform thorough code reviews and provide useful constructive feedback.
  • Embrace rapid iterative design, testing, and development to gain context and understanding along the way informing the next useful step in delivering value
  • Develop proof of concepts and incremental features within the merchant experience ecosystem, while ensuring contributions meet Recharge design and code standards
  • Investigate, analyze, and evangelize programming methodologies
  • Champion good habits (development techniques, security, and tech debt balance) amongst your peers while advocating for improved engineering standards, tooling, and processes
  • Collaborate with product and engineering management to inform roadmap timeline and identify approaches to release product features incrementally
